Doogee introduced the DK10 smartphone in 2024. This phone boasts a 6.67 inch AMOLED display, a Mediatek Dimensity 8020 chipset, and 12 GB of RAM. The smartphone runs on the Android OS v13.0 operating system.

System, chipset, performance

OS versionAndroid OS v13.0
SoCMediatek Dimensity 8020
CPUOcta-core, Quad-core 2.6 GHz Cortex-A78, Quad-core 2 GHz Cortex-A55
GPUMali-G77 MC9
PerformanceAnTuTu v10: 739759

The Doogee DK10 comes with Android OS v13.0 out of the box. Android is an open-source operating system. This means users and developers have more control over the software. This CPU makes it ideal for running resource-intensive applications. Many people consider ARM Mali GPUs a good option for mobile devices. AnTuTu measures and evaluates the performance of different hardware components of a device.

Battery type, capacity, charger

TypeLi-Po 5150 mAh, non-removable
Charger120 W

The Li-Po 5150 mAh, non-removable battery gives the smartphone a good battery backup. The lithium polymer (Li-Po) battery is a light-weight, rechargeable battery. The DK10 does not have a removable battery, it integrates the battery into the phone's design.
